Output e27511575d120138de21561d9c23f89bcf963a639ec0d1535362af81bce72141:0

value
880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67e70f888ff00072060cf6c451c94481b4d79cdb OP_EQUAL
address
3BAQKgNURX31KjxNUi3B1P1tyfjskgEyP2
transaction
e27511575d120138de21561d9c23f89bcf963a639ec0d1535362af81bce72141
spent
true